Bagikan melalui


DbProviderServices Kelas

Definisi

Penting

API ini bukan kompatibel CLS.

Pabrik untuk membangun definisi perintah; gunakan jenis objek ini sebagai argumen ke metode IServiceProvider.GetService pada pabrik penyedia.

public ref class DbProviderServices abstract
public abstract class DbProviderServices
[System.CLSCompliant(false)]
public abstract class DbProviderServices
type DbProviderServices = class
[<System.CLSCompliant(false)>]
type DbProviderServices = class
Public MustInherit Class DbProviderServices
Warisan
DbProviderServices
Turunan
Atribut

Konstruktor

DbProviderServices()

Menginisialisasi instans baru kelas DbProviderServices.

Metode

CreateCommandDefinition(DbCommand)

Membuat definisi perintah yang menggunakan perintah tertentu.

CreateCommandDefinition(DbCommandTree)

Membuat definisi perintah dari pohon perintah.

CreateCommandDefinition(DbProviderManifest, DbCommandTree)

Membuat definisi perintah dari manifes dan pohon perintah yang ditentukan.

CreateDatabase(DbConnection, Nullable<Int32>, StoreItemCollection)

Membuat database yang ditunjukkan oleh koneksi dan membuat objek skema.

CreateDatabaseScript(String, StoreItemCollection)

Menghasilkan bahasa definisi data (skrip DDL yang membuat objek skema (tabel, kunci primer, kunci asing) berdasarkan konten parameter StoreItemCollection dan ditargetkan untuk versi database yang sesuai dengan token manifes penyedia.

CreateDbCommandDefinition(DbProviderManifest, DbCommandTree)

Membuat objek definisi perintah untuk manifes penyedia dan pohon perintah yang ditentukan.

DatabaseExists(DbConnection, Nullable<Int32>, StoreItemCollection)

Mengembalikan nilai yang menunjukkan apakah database tertentu ada di server dan apakah objek skema yang terkandung dalam storeItemCollection telah dibuat.

DbCreateDatabase(DbConnection, Nullable<Int32>, StoreItemCollection)

Membuat database yang ditunjukkan oleh koneksi dan membuat objek skema (tabel, kunci primer, kunci asing) berdasarkan konten StoreItemCollection.

DbCreateDatabaseScript(String, StoreItemCollection)

Menghasilkan bahasa definisi data (skrip DDL yang membuat objek skema (tabel, kunci primer, kunci asing) berdasarkan konten parameter StoreItemCollection dan ditargetkan untuk versi database yang sesuai dengan token manifes penyedia.

DbDatabaseExists(DbConnection, Nullable<Int32>, StoreItemCollection)

Mengembalikan nilai yang menunjukkan apakah database tertentu ada di server dan apakah objek skema yang terkandung dalam storeItemCollection telah dibuat.

DbDeleteDatabase(DbConnection, Nullable<Int32>, StoreItemCollection)

Menghapus semua objek penyimpanan yang ditentukan dalam kumpulan item penyimpanan dari database dan database itu sendiri.

DbGetSpatialServices(String)

Mendapatkan layanan spasial untuk DbProviderServices.

DeleteDatabase(DbConnection, Nullable<Int32>, StoreItemCollection)

Menghapus semua objek penyimpanan yang ditentukan dalam kumpulan item penyimpanan dari database dan database itu sendiri.

Equals(Object)

Menentukan apakah objek yang ditentukan sama dengan objek saat ini.

(Diperoleh dari Object)
GetDbProviderManifest(String)

Saat ditimpa di kelas turunan, mengembalikan instans kelas yang berasal dari DbProviderManifest.

GetDbProviderManifestToken(DbConnection)

Mengembalikan token manifes penyedia yang diberikan koneksi.

GetDbSpatialDataReader(DbDataReader, String)

Mendapatkan pembaca data spasial untuk DbProviderServices.

GetHashCode()

Berfungsi sebagai fungsi hash default.

(Diperoleh dari Object)
GetProviderFactory(DbConnection)

Mengambil DbProviderFactory berdasarkan DbConnection yang ditentukan.

GetProviderManifest(String)

Mengembalikan manifes penyedia dengan menggunakan informasi versi yang ditentukan.

GetProviderManifestToken(DbConnection)

Mengembalikan token manifes penyedia.

GetProviderServices(DbConnection)

Mengembalikan penyedia yang diberi koneksi.

GetSpatialDataReader(DbDataReader, String)

Mendapatkan pembaca data spasial untuk DbProviderServices.

GetSpatialServices(String)

Mendapatkan layanan spasial untuk DbProviderServices.

GetType()

Mendapatkan dari instans Type saat ini.

(Diperoleh dari Object)
MemberwiseClone()

Membuat salinan dangkal dari saat ini Object.

(Diperoleh dari Object)
SetDbParameterValue(DbParameter, TypeUsage, Object)

Mengatur nilai parameter untuk DbProviderServices.

ToString()

Mengembalikan string yang mewakili objek saat ini.

(Diperoleh dari Object)

Berlaku untuk